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5440141 25764754 3515 81141088 53174
114862500 379
114862500 379
399121 39 1293323407 50 7135
All about undefined
Interested in learning more?
114862500 379
399121 39 1293323407 50 7135
See more
88 59
3449184049 24758375 695 5094
See more
688915549 960 48
46376283 65799730831 68 79
See more